Protect Your Home by Siding: The Value-Increasing Method

 


Your home is shielded by siding from inclement weather, including snow, rain, strong winds, and other extreme factors. Your interior is protected from the winter's bitter cold by correctly constructed siding. In addition, it holds onto the heat generated in your house, keeping you toasty and cozy. When siding fails, moisture and water seep into the structure of your home, leading to interior damage such as wood rot and mold formation.   • Lowers Painting and Upkeep Expenses

Painting expenses can be minimized by choosing fiber cement and vinyl siding. Fiber cement siding holds its color twice as long as conventional siding materials, while vinyl siding doesn't require painting. Since neither of these materials ages, chips, cracks, or flakes, you can stop painting and scraping your house every few years and save money on paying for new paint with professionals like Merrick Residential Roofing. Fiber cement or vinyl siding materials require little to no upkeep to maintain their attractiveness when replacing them. Because of their robustness, you won't have to replace them as frequently, giving you more time to enjoy your room worry-free.
